USA COLLEGE ARCHERY PROGRAM
7-10 July 2008

The World University Championships will be held in Chinese Taipei Jul 7-10, 2008. USA Archery, College Archery Program will be fielding a full team to this event. (3 each from Women compound, men compound, women recurve, men recurve plus 2 coaches and 1 team leader).

Team selection: The USA team trials will run concurrently with 2008 USIACs to be held in Cape May, New Jersey. The top three finishers in each class from the FITA portion of the tournament (qualifying round) will form the 2008 USA WUAC team.

Competition events: Team USA will compete in the Individual qualifications, elimination rounds, and team rounds. The top man and woman from each division in the qualification round will compete in the mixed team round.

Competition format: Qualification round is a double 70meter round. Elimination matches are also competed at 70meters. Team round is competed at 70m on a ‘hit or miss’ target, as is mixed team round.

Team rounds: Only the top 16 teams will compete in team round. Mixed team round: only the top 8 teams will compete.
